实时指南:高效建库与长效运维
|
在当今快速发展的互联网环境中,构建一个高效且可扩展的数据库系统是网站架构师的核心职责之一。选择合适的数据库类型、设计合理的数据模型以及制定清晰的索引策略,都是确保系统性能和稳定性的重要因素。 在建库过程中,需要充分考虑业务需求与未来扩展性。初期应避免过度设计,但也要为可能的增长预留空间。例如,采用分库分表策略可以有效提升读写性能,同时降低单点故障的风险。 运维层面同样不可忽视,建立完善的监控体系是保障系统长期稳定运行的关键。通过实时监控数据库的CPU、内存、连接数及查询延迟等指标,能够及时发现潜在问题并进行干预。 自动化运维工具的引入可以显著提高效率。从备份恢复到配置管理,再到故障自愈,自动化流程不仅减少了人为错误,也提升了响应速度。同时,定期进行压力测试和性能调优,有助于发现系统瓶颈并优化资源利用率。
AI绘图,仅供参考 数据安全始终是数据库管理的重中之重。实施严格的访问控制、加密存储以及审计日志记录,能够在保障数据完整性的同时,满足合规性要求。制定详细的灾难恢复计划,并定期演练,也是防范重大风险的有效手段。持续学习与迭代是保持系统竞争力的重要方式。随着技术的不断演进,定期评估现有架构,引入新技术或优化现有方案,有助于构建更高效、更可靠的数据库环境。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330475号